Mr. Farías joined Ford Foundation in 1998.
Previously, he was the founding director general of the College of the Southern Border in Chiapas, Mexico, a research institute focused on the challenges of poverty alleviation, sustainable development in tropical rural areas and population dynamics in Mexico's southern border region.
He also served on the board of Mexico's National Council on Science and Technology and the national advisory councils on sustainable development and social development.
Mr. Farías began his career working on community health concerns among Latino immigrants in the East Cambridge and Jamaica Plain areas of Boston.
He later worked in social medicine and mental health in the refugee camps along the Mexico-Guatemala border and helped establish the Comitan Center for Health Research, an organization focused on reproductive health, community mental health and local development in rural areas.
Mr. Farías studied medicine at the University of Monterrey and trained in psychiatry and medical anthropology at Harvard Medical School and the Cambridge Hospital.
He was also a Dupont-Warren research fellow and lecturer in social medicine at Harvard Medical School.
He is a native of Monterrey, Mexico.
